Analysis

The most recent figure for mean years of schooling (isced 1 or higher), population 25+ years in Korea is 12.12, measured in 2015. That is the highest value across all 11 years on record.

The figure is up 7.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, mean years of schooling (isced 1 or higher), population 25+ years in Korea peaked at 12.12 in 2015 and was at its lowest, 5.4, in 1970.

That places Korea 36th out of 124 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.

Mean years of schooling (ISCED 1 or higher), population 25+ years in Korea, year by year

Annual values for Mean years of schooling (ISCED 1 or higher), population 25+ years, both sexes in Korea, 1970 to 2015.
Year Value Change
1970 5.4
1975 6.6 +22.2%
1980 7.26 +10.1%
1985 9.39 +29.3%
1990 9.27 -1.2%
1995 10 +7.8%
2000 10.62 +6.2%
2005 11.24 +5.9%
2009 10.87 -3.3%
2010 11.64 +7.0%
2015 12.12 +4.1%
